The Evolution of Internet Betting
Online gambling has transformed significantly since its start in the mid-1990s . The initial phase were marked by a handful of sites that offered simple card games and slots, drawing in a niche audience. With the advent of the Internet and enhanced technology, these platforms began to evolve quickly. The introduction of safe payment systems allowed for more secure transactions, which in turn encouraged more users to delve into the realm of online gambling .
As the new millennium approached, a surge in the popularity of online casinos emerged. Creative game designs and sophisticated user interfaces made gambling more accessible and appealing for players. Furthermore, the growth of mobile technology changed how people interacted with gambling platforms. Players could now place bets from their smartphones and tablets , leading to a significant increase in user engagement and participation .
In the past few years, the evolution of online gambling has been heavily impacted by advancements in technology such as VR and AI. These technologies have created immersive and tailored gaming experiences that were previously inconceivable. Additionally, the approval and regulation of online gambling in various jurisdictions have contributed to its widespread acceptance, making it a popular form of entertainment in today’s digital age.
